How to do JAMB Regularization

JAMB Regularization is the process of ensuring that the Joint Admissions and Matriculation Board (JAMB) validates your current admission details with the Tertiary institution that offered you admission in their database, with the aim of securing the admission and granting admission letter/registration number.Information Guide Nigeria

The JAMB regularization process was created to help settle down or regulate ND, OND, HND, and NCE admissions into universities and clear up the prospective student status on the JAMB portal.How to download JAMB Admission Letter

Who needs JAMB Regularization?

The JAMB regularization procedures are for students who fall under the following categories:

  • ND, OND, HND, and NCE students still having prospective student status on JAMB portal
  • Students who have been offered admission by tertiary institutions but does not have an admission letter from JAMB
  • Students who entered into tertiary institutions through remedial/pre-degree programmes like BASIC programme, CERTIFICATE programme, or direct application to the school.
  • Students who did not register for the JAMB UTME/DE exam during the year they were offered admissionNpower recruitment

The JAMB regularization procedure allows candidates with admission from a tertiary institution but with no prior record on JAMB portal to register on the platform.

Requirements for JAMB Regularization

To successfully carry out the JAMB regularization procedure, the following documents /details will be required:

  • For applicants with a valid JAMB registration number, you will be required to present your JAMB result printout
  • O’Level Results which include; WAEC, NECO, GCE, or NABTEB
  • A passport photograph
  • Applicants’ personal details including; Full name, home address, Date of birth, email address, Phone number, gender, marital status, state or LGA of origin, previous JAMB registration number, year of enrolment
  • Applicants’ institution details which includes; Name of institution enrolled, reason for not being on JAMB list, school matriculation number, matriculation year, year of graduation, serial no. On graduating list, registrar, head of institution, etc.
  • Course of study in the tertiary institutionWAEC result

How to do JAMB Regularization

To do JAMB regularization, follow the procedures below:

  • Step 1: Visit any JAMB approved CBT centre close to you
  • Step 2: Go with all the required documents as listed above
  • Step 3: You will be required to make a payment for processing your JAMB regularization
  • Step 4: The JAMB official will then commence your JAMB regularization
  • Step 5: After your details have been confirmed, the JAMB official will proceed to complete the form
  • Step 6: After submission of the form, obtain a printout from the JAMB official
  • Step 7: Ensure that the printout is signed and stamped by the JAMB official
  • Step 8: Submit the signed form to your school’s admission office
  • Step 9: Your school’s admission officer will then submit the form to the JAMB state office or to the Abuja office
  • Step 10: You will receive a notification from JAMB to your email addressJAMB form

How to Check your JAMB Regularisation Status

To check if your JAMB Regularisation has been successful, follow the procedures below:

  • Step 1: Visit the official JAMB portal via Https://portal.jamb.gov.ng/efacility../
  • Step 2: Enter your registered JAMB email and password
  • Step 3: Navigate to “check admission status” tab or “CAPS” and click on it
  • Step 4: Enter your examination year and JAMB registration
  • Step 5: Now click on “check admission status” to access your admission status
  • Step 6: If your JAMB Regularisation has been approved, you’ll be able to print your admission letterJAMB Result
